The Birth Party
We have a tradition that started with my first born and it has proven to be the perfect beginning and celebration as we've welcomed each baby into our home. We simply celebrate the baby's birth - day party with decorations, presents, cake and icecream. Grandma and Grandpa arrived less than 24 hours after Isaac and I were released from the hopsital so within just a few hours of them being here with us, we started the party.
Because Travis and Sloan had both celebrated thier birthdays the same week that Isaac was born, I spent one afternoon baking about 50 cupcakes to cover us for all three parties. Travis had the chocolate ones, Sloan had the lemon ones and there were both flavors left for Isaac's party to have some of each kind. We sang "Happy Birthday" to him but there were no candles to blow out since that part of the party he'll have to earn at his one year old party.
